- Description: Alexandra David-Néel, a French explorer and writer, is renowned for her extraordinary travels in Asia and for being one of the first Western women to visit Tibet, which was then closed to foreigners. Starting her explorations in 1911, she traversed regions such as India, China, Japan, and Tibet, braving extreme conditions and overcoming cultural and physical barriers. Her most famous journey was to Tibet, where she surreptitiously entered in 1924, reaching Lhasa. David-Néel was not just an adventurer but also a scholar of Buddhism and Asian cultures, and her numerous books, including "My Journey to Lhasa," provide a vivid and insightful portrayal of her experiences and discoveries

- Description: Clarence M. Darling and Claude C. Murphey departed from the Hotel Otsego in Jackson on May 2, 1904. After traveling 13'407 miles and a year and three months, they returned to the Michigan town having completed a tour of the United States following a bet. They lost the bet in Vermont, where they were unable to meet the 'financial' clauses of the wager: "The conditions were that they were to start on this long journey penniless, while on the trip they were neither to beg, work, borrow, nor steal, all the expenses of the tour to be met by the profits resulting from the sale of an aluminum card-receiver or ash-tray"

- Description: Thomas Fleming Day was an influential American journalist and sailor known for his pioneering voyages in sailing. The founder and editor of "The Rudder" magazine, Day was prominent in promoting the sport of sailing and his sailing exploits. In 1911, he led the famous "Atlantic Race," one of the first yachting races across the Atlantic Ocean, from New York to Cornwall, England. His leadership in this event made him a legendary figure in the history of sailing. Day was also renowned for his writings, which combined technical expertise with a lively narrative style, inspiring generations of sailors and adventurers

- Description: De Hass was the American consul in Jerusalem: in 1879, he managed to beat Phileas Fogg's record. According to reports from some newspapers of the time, it took him 68 days

- Description: Catherine de Bourboulon was one of the earliest Western explorers in China during the 19th century. As the wife of the French diplomat Alexandre de Bourboulon, France's general consul in China, she accompanied her husband on numerous diplomatic journeys across Asia. Her letters and travel diaries, filled with sharp observations and detailed descriptions, provide a vivid picture of East Asia during a time of significant change. Catherine was not just a witness but also an active participant in these journeys, significantly contributing to the West's understanding of China and East Asia during her era
